Client Story:
Center for Labor & a Just Economy

Early in 2022, Sharon Block transitioned from the United States Department of Labor to lead Harvard’s Labor and Worklife Program. Cognizant of the quickly-shifting labor landscape, Ms. Block engaged SSA to develop a stakeholder survey and engage dozens of donors, labor thought leaders, staff, and more, in a series of interviews to capture and distill valuable feedback on the positioning and unique value proposition of the Program. SSA also led a landscape analysis of peer academic institutions and a communications refresh, including rebranding the Program to the Center for Labor and a Just Economy. This work resulted in a report laying out recommendations for strategic organizational priorities based on work conducted throughout the engagement.
